清晰而實用地介紹了骨水泥輸送系統如何影響臨床工作流程、設備設計重點和手術結果。

目前,骨水泥輸送系統的發展現況兼顧了臨床需求和技術成熟度,廣泛應用於整形外科、脊椎外科、口腔外科和創傷治療等領域。這些輸送機制在確保骨水泥在混合和植入過程中具有一致的操作特性、無菌性和治療效果方面發揮著至關重要的作用。近年來,臨床實踐中可重複性和污染控制的重要性日益凸顯,製造商正積極響應這一需求,研發創新技術以降低手術差異並提高手術效率。

全面的細分洞察揭示了劑型、臨床應用、最終用戶環境和材料特性如何決定產品的採用和設計重點。

深入的市場細分闡明了臨床需求與產品創新在給藥系統類型、應用、終端用戶和材料類型方面的交匯點。就給藥系統類型而言,自動化混合系統因其能夠降低變異性並提高無菌性(與手動混合系統相比)而備受關注;而真空混合系統則在孔隙率控制和水泥機械性能至關重要時更受歡迎。了解這三種方法之間的權衡對於產品定位和臨床導入策略至關重要。從應用角度來看,與髖關節、膝關節和肩關節置換等關節重建置換術相比,牙科應用(包括根管治療和植入)在操作和劑量方面有獨特的限制。關節重建手術對水泥黏度和固化時間的要求因手術部位而異。脊椎手術(例如脊椎後凸和椎體成形術)需要支援微創入路和水泥流動控制的給藥系統,而創傷固定術(包括外固定和內固定)則需要能夠應對術中突發情況並允許快速切換手術方案的設備。

A clear and practical introduction to how bone cement delivery systems influence clinical workflows, device design priorities, and surgical outcomes

The landscape for bone cement delivery systems sits at the intersection of clinical necessity and technological refinement, supporting a broad range of orthopedic, spinal, dental, and trauma procedures. These delivery mechanisms perform a critical role in ensuring consistent handling properties, sterility, and therapeutic performance of bone cements during mixing and implantation. Over recent years the clinical community has emphasized reproducibility and contamination control, and manufacturers have responded with innovations that reduce variability and improve procedural ergonomics.

Clinicians increasingly demand devices that simplify intraoperative workflows while preserving the mechanical and biological characteristics of bone cement formulations. Concurrently, regulatory scrutiny and payer interest in outcomes place a premium on systems that can demonstrably improve procedural efficiency and reduce infection risk. As a result, investment in device-level enhancements and complementary materials science is accelerating, with an emphasis on systems that integrate with modern operating-room logistics and sterilization protocols.

This analysis provides a framework for understanding how delivery system design, material innovation, and evolving clinical pathways converge to shape adoption. It highlights the practical implications for hospitals, surgical centers, and device manufacturers, and sets the stage for deeper exploration of competitive dynamics, material trends, and regional variations that follow in subsequent sections.

A strategic review of the major technological, clinical, and regulatory forces driving rapid evolution and innovation in bone cement delivery systems

Several transformative shifts are reshaping the bone cement delivery system landscape, driven by technological refinement, clinical expectations, and regulatory emphasis on safety and reproducibility. First, the maturation of automated mixing platforms and closed-system technologies is reducing operator variability and contamination risk, and these technologies are increasingly evaluated through the lens of procedural time-savings and sterility assurance. Second, materials innovation-particularly around antibiotic-loaded polymethyl methacrylate formulations and bioactive calcium phosphate variants-has prompted device designers to tailor delivery mechanisms that preserve material integrity and enable precise dosing.

Third, clinical practice is evolving as outpatient procedures and ambulatory surgical centers expand their role in orthopedics and spine care, creating demand for compact, user-friendly delivery systems that can be reliably used across care settings. Fourth, the regulatory environment is placing more emphasis on traceability, labeling, and post-market surveillance, which in turn encourages manufacturers to incorporate data-capture capabilities and quality-by-design principles into product roadmaps. These shifts interact to favor systems that integrate seamlessly with hospital supply chains, support standardized protocols, and provide clinical teams with predictable performance under varying procedural conditions.

Taken together, these drivers indicate a market that rewards interoperability, sterile handling, and adaptable design. As stakeholders prioritize patient safety and operating-room efficiency, delivery system developers who align product features with clinician needs and regulatory expectations will be best positioned to capture adoption in diverse care settings.

An analytical assessment of how 2025 tariff measures have reshaped supply chains, procurement choices, and regional manufacturing strategies across the bone cement delivery ecosystem

The imposition of tariffs and trade policy adjustments in 2025 has introduced palpable pressure across global supply chains for medical devices and raw materials used in bone cement systems. Manufacturers that rely on imported polymers, additives, or specialized mixing equipment have had to re-evaluate sourcing strategies, negotiate new supplier contracts, and consider reshoring or nearshoring options to mitigate exposure to tariff-induced cost volatility. These responses have implications for procurement lead times, inventory planning, and capital allocation for regional manufacturing capabilities.

Clinicians and hospital procurement teams have encountered altered pricing dynamics that influence purchasing decisions for both single-use delivery components and capital equipment such as automated mixing systems. In some cases, institutions are prioritizing longer product life cycles and repairability to offset higher acquisition costs, while others are re-assessing vendor contracts to secure bundled pricing or extended service agreements. Likewise, suppliers of key polymers used in polymethyl methacrylate variants and precursors for calcium phosphate materials have explored forward-buying and alternative feedstocks to stabilize supply.

Regulatory and reimbursement frameworks have not changed uniformly in response to trade measures, so manufacturers must navigate region-specific cost pass-throughs and procurement rules. Strategic responses that prove most effective include diversifying supplier networks, increasing component standardization across product lines to leverage economies of scale, and investing in regional distribution and local assembly capabilities to reduce tariff exposure. In short, the 2025 trade environment has accelerated a shift toward more resilient and geographically diversified supply chains for bone cement delivery systems.

Comprehensive segmentation insights that reveal how delivery type, clinical application, end-user setting, and material characteristics determine adoption and product design priorities

Insightful segmentation clarifies where clinical demand and product innovation intersect across delivery system type, application, end user, and material type. When examined by delivery system type, automated mixing systems command attention for their capacity to reduce variability and improve sterility compared with hand mixing systems, while vacuum mixing systems are often preferred where porosity control and cement mechanical properties are paramount; understanding the trade-offs among these three approaches is essential for product positioning and clinical adoption strategies. Looking through the lens of application, dental applications encompass endodontics and implants and impose distinct handling and dosing constraints compared with joint replacement procedures, where hip, knee, and shoulder replacements each present different cement viscosity and setting-time requirements; spinal surgery use cases such as kyphoplasty and vertebroplasty demand delivery systems that support minimally invasive access and controlled cement flow, and trauma fixation scenarios-spanning external and internal fixation-require devices that can accommodate intraoperative unpredictability and rapid procedural turnaround.

From an end user perspective, ambulatory surgical centers, clinics, and hospitals exhibit divergent purchasing behaviors and operational needs: ambulatory centers often prioritize compact, easy-to-use systems with rapid setup, clinics may emphasize cost-effective single-use solutions and simplified workflows, and hospitals typically seek robust, service-backed equipment that integrates with broader sterilization and inventory management systems. Material type also dictates delivery system compatibility and clinical outcomes; calcium phosphate materials, including brushite and hydroxyapatite subtypes, present bioactive profiles that influence resorption and bone remodeling, while polymethyl methacrylate formulations-available as antibiotic-loaded or non-antibiotic variants-require delivery systems designed to maintain homogenous antibiotic dispersion and consistent mechanical performance. Parsing these segmentation dimensions provides actionable clarity for commercial leaders to align product portfolios with the nuanced requirements of clinicians, procurement teams, and surgical settings.

Region-specific strategic factors that influence product adoption, regulatory alignment, and commercialization approaches across global healthcare markets

Regional dynamics materially shape adoption pathways, regulatory expectations, and commercial strategies across the Americas, Europe, Middle East & Africa, and Asia-Pacific regions. In the Americas, health systems emphasize cost containment and outcomes-driven procurement, with hospitals and ambulatory surgical centers focusing on procedural efficiency and infection control; this creates opportunities for delivery systems that demonstrate measurable reductions in operating time and contamination risk. Across Europe, Middle East & Africa, diverse regulatory regimes and variable healthcare infrastructure require adaptable go-to-market approaches, with some markets favoring high-specification automated systems and others prioritizing cost-effective, scalable solutions that can be deployed across varied clinical environments.

In the Asia-Pacific region, rapid expansion of elective orthopedic and dental procedures, alongside growing domestic manufacturing capabilities, encourages localized product modifications and strategic partnerships with regional distributors and clinical centers. Transitional implications include the need for manufacturers to tailor training, service models, and spare-parts logistics to regional expectations, while also ensuring compliance with differing device regulations and sterilization standards. Taken together, these geographic realities demand that companies adopt region-specific commercialization tactics that balance global product consistency with local customization, supply chain resilience, and regulatory alignment.

Competitive and collaborative company dynamics that clarify which capabilities drive preference and how partnerships enhance product differentiation and market access

Competitive dynamics in the bone cement delivery system arena are defined by a mixture of legacy device manufacturers, specialized material suppliers, and agile new entrants focused on niche clinical needs. Established medical device firms leverage broad distribution networks and long-standing hospital relationships to embed delivery systems within bundled offerings, while specialized companies concentrate on refining mixing technologies, closed-system solutions, and single-use disposables that address contamination and workflow challenges. Newer entrants often differentiate through software-enabled features, data capture for traceability, or innovations that simplify point-of-care handling.

Partnerships between material formulators and device developers are increasingly common, enabling co-designed systems that optimize cement handling and clinical outcomes. Similarly, strategic alliances with surgical centers and academic hospitals provide real-world evidence that supports market access and clinician adoption. Commercial competition therefore revolves around three core capabilities: the ability to demonstrate consistent clinical performance and sterility, the efficiency and ergonomics of the delivery system in diverse care settings, and the strength of post-sale service and training programs. Companies that integrate these capabilities while maintaining regulatory and supply chain resilience are likely to secure preferential positioning among institutional buyers.
